What 11379NAT Really Is

The full title is the 11379NAT Course in Initial Response to a Mental Health Crisis. It is a country wide approved short training course in Australia, provided on training.gov.au, and supplied by Registered Training Organisations under ASQA accredited courses frameworks. Unlike a broad mental health certificate that covers long-term conditions and psychosocial assistance, this program is objective constructed for the first minutes to hours of a dilemma. It instructs you to secure the scenario, reduce immediate danger, and connect the individual to appropriate help.

People that complete the 11379NAT mental health course usually work in duties where situation can emerge without warning: front-line managers, instructors, security, customer support, physical fitness team, HUMAN RESOURCES, union associates, volunteers, and community leaders. It also fits any person working as a mental health support officer inside an organisation, specifically where peer support and early intervention are priorities.

The certification is part of nationally accredited training. That suggests the material, assessment conditions, and results are standardised and examined. When companies ask for accredited mental health courses or a mental health certification that is portable across states and sectors, this course sits on the short list that fulfills that test.

The Point of a Dilemma Course, Not Therapy

A crisis mental health course differs from counselling training or a general mental health course in one crucial way. It asks, what must be done securely now? A dilemma can include suicidal thinking with a plan, self-harm, acute stress and anxiety or panic that disrupts feature, serious depressive episodes, substance-related distress, psychosis with or without agitation, and reactions to trauma. The course shows you to acknowledge the indications, perform first danger checks, and pick the next best action within your scope.

You will certainly not appear as a medical professional. You will not detect. You will certainly discover a dependable method that protects against common errors: minimising the person's distress, leaping straight to recommendations, missing safety threats, or intensifying a circumstance through bad language or stance. Think about it as first aid for mental health, the means a physical emergency treatment program takes care of bleeding or burns. You provide initial treatment and hand over to the best level of support.

Core Skills You Can Expect to Practise

This isn't a slide-deck course. The far better carriers construct actual scenario work into every system and examine exactly how you use skills with people, not just how you recall facts. Over the arc of the program, you should practise:

Recognising an establishing mental health crisis and differentiating it from regular distress. The line can be blurred. The program instructs you to search for adjustments in speech, stance, agitation, coherence, sense of reality, and statements about harm. Establishing first call that prioritises security and self-respect. You will certainly get comfy with ordinary language, non-threatening position and spacing, and approval where appropriate. Asking straight concerns about self-destruction or self-harm without euphemisms. You find out to use details, respectful wording and how to handle your own discomfort while you analyze risk. De-escalation and grounding techniques. Simple, repeatable strategies for controling breathing, decreasing arousal, and minimizing stimulations in the environment. Safety preparation and instant referral. Recognizing when to call triple zero, just how to involve household or assistance people with authorization, and just how to document activities in line with policy.

Those are the hands-on pieces. You additionally cover lawful and honest boundaries, privacy and approval, mandated coverage in certain contexts, and the navigating of neighborhood service paths. The far better programs localise the reference map, because "call someone" is worthless if you do not understand that and exactly how at 3 a.m.

Units, Evaluation, and What 'Competency' Means

Nationally accredited training utilizes competency-based analysis. You are regarded competent when you continually show the needed abilities and understanding under sensible conditions. With 11379NAT, that generally incorporates expertise get in touch with observed simulations and scenario-based wondering about. Anticipate role-play with a facilitator or star, created reactions to case studies, and a sensible analysis where you should apply a structured reaction to a specified crisis.

Time commitments vary by carrier, but a typical shipment extends one to 2 full days with pre-reading, then sensible assessment activities. Some companies split it throughout shorter sessions to accommodate change workers. You'll usually have between 6 and 12 hours of call time, with additional time for analysis completion.

The certificate of accomplishment you get is identified across Australia due to the fact that it sits within nationally accredited courses. Companies that request for evidence of first aid in mental health or first aid for mental health training will certainly identify it, and insurance companies progressively search for accredited training on file when they underwrite programs linked to psychosocial hazards.

The Refresher course Inquiry: When and Why

Competency discolors. The 11379NAT mental health correspondence course exists therefore. Policies vary by company, yet a 12 to 24 month refresher cycle is common. The mental health refresher course 11379NAT is shorter, typically half a day, and focuses on ability wedding rehearsal, updates to standards, and situation experiment fresh, high-friction cases. If your duty entails normal contact with the general public or students, refreshing yearly is more than a conformity box. It maintains your language sharp and your self-confidence intact.

One sign that a refresher course is past due: you hesitate to ask a straight concern concerning self-destruction. One more: you find on your own failing to suggestions instead of assessment. What Counts as a Mental Health Crisis?

Definitions differ by policy, but you can identify a situation by the merging of danger, damaged feature, and time stress. Instances include a teenager that has stopped resting for days and is listening to voices, a worker who confesses to having a prepare for suicide and the ways to carry it out, a customer in apparent panic drinking and wheezing, incapable to talk, or an individual intoxicated whose behaviour swings quickly and unpredictably.

The training course does not ask you to choose cause. It trains you to analyze immediate threat and respond. Also in grey zones, the 11379NAT strategy assists. If a person is distressed and possibly in danger but participating, you approach grounding, helpful talk, and connection to services. If there impends danger, you prioritise emergency solutions and safety and security for all entailed. In either instance, your language is plain, your position is non-confrontational, and your paperwork is factual.

Assessment Nerves and How to Take care of Them

Plenty of qualified individuals tense up at the idea of role-play. The method is to deal with the assessment like a drill, not an efficiency. You can make it less complicated on yourself by practicing three anchors the evening prior to:

Openers: a couple of words to begin with security and authorization. "I'm observing you appear really bewildered. I 'd like to inspect exactly how you're feeling and make sure you're secure. Is it alright if we talk right here, or would certainly you favor somewhere quieter?" Direct danger inquiries: short, clear, no euphemisms. "Are you thinking about self-destruction?" "Have you thought of just how you might do it?" "Do you have access to what you 'd utilize?" Handovers: concise, factual, and collective. "You have actually told me the thoughts are intense and you have actually considered tablets. I'm concerned about your security. Allow's call the situation line with each other now, and I can stay while we speak with them."

These are not scripts to state. They are waypoints you can adjust. In an assessment, the assessor tries to find evidence that you noticed indicators, asked straight, reduced instant risk, and connected assistance. Fancy wording impresses nobody. Clearness does.

Ethical Sides and Grey Areas

Real life will certainly check the neatness of any type of training. 2 recurring side situations should have attention.

First, discretion versus safety. If a person reveals suicidal intent and asks you not to inform anyone, you can not assure secrecy where safety and security goes to danger. The program shows language that appreciates freedom while being truthful concerning limitations. "I appreciate your personal privacy, and I'll maintain this as exclusive as I can, yet I can't maintain this to myself if your security goes to risk. Allow's exercise with each other that we involve."

Second, authorization and capacity. In severe psychosis or drunkenness, an individual may not be able to grant certain actions. The course helps you identify when to rise to emergency situation solutions and just how to connect comfortably while help gets on the means. Your role is to reduce the temperature level, lower stimulations, and keep physical safety front of mind.

In both situations, regional plan and legislation lead the last call. Excellent training factors you to those frameworks as opposed to leaving you to guess.

A Brief, Practical Checklist You Can Make Use Of Tomorrow

Notice and name: state what you're observing without judgment, invite a brief check-in, and choose a quieter room if possible. Ask straight concerning damage: make use of clear, considerate inquiries concerning self-destruction or self-harm, and listen to the responses without flinching. Lower arousal: lower noise and crowding, slow your speech, suggest paced breathing or a focal object, and prevent abrupt movements. Decide on the handover: situation line, GP, emergency services, or a trusted support person, and entail the individual in the decision where safe. Document factually: time, observations, specific phrasing where relevant, activities taken, and who you handed over to, in line with policy.

Pin this where your team can see it. It mirrors the spine of the training course and keeps every person aligned.
